#808d9c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#808d9c is composed of 50.2% red, 55.3%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.9% cyan, 9.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 212.1 degrees, a saturation of 12.4% and a lightness of 55.7%. #808d9c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#011b39.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#808d9c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#808d9c has RGB values of R:128, G:141,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 8424860.

Hex triplet 808d9c #808d9c
RGB Decimal 128, 141, 156 rgb(128,141,156)
RGB Percent 50.2, 55.3, 61.2 rgb(50.2%,55.3%,61.2%)
CMYK 18, 10, 0, 39
HSL 212.1°, 12.4, 55.7 hsl(212.1,12.4%,55.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 212.1°, 17.9, 61.2
Web Safe 999999 #999999
CIE-LAB 58.074, -1.394, -9.537
XYZ 24.426, 26.039, 35.19
xyY 0.285, 0.304, 26.039
CIE-LCH 58.074, 9.639, 261.686
CIE-LUV 58.074, -7.665, -13.714
Hunter-Lab 51.028, -3.854, -5.167
Binary 10000000, 10001101, 10011100

Shades and Tints of #808d9c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040505 is the darkest color, while #f9faf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#808d9c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898e93 is the less saturated color, while #2086fc is the most saturated one.
